Quest 3's Windows 11 Remote Desktop Gets Aspect Ratio Setting & Ultrawide Mode

October 14, 2025 4 Min Read
Share
4 Min Read
Quest 3's Windows 11 Remote Desktop Gets Aspect Ratio Setting & Ultrawide Mode
SHARE

The official Home windows 11 Distant Desktop of Horizon OS now has side ratio choices for the digital displays and an enveloping visionOS-like Ultrawide Mode.

The Home windows 11 integration, a results of Meta and Microsoft’s partnership in XR, arrived as an experimental function nearly a 12 months in the past. It lets Quest 3 and Quest 3S wearers mirror their Home windows 11 PC with a single faucet of a digital button that seems over the keyboard. The bodily monitor turns off and is changed by a big digital display, and you may spawn digital aspect screens for a complete of three displays. And these displays are all home windows in Horizon OS, so might be stored open inside VR and blended actuality apps.

The expertise of Meta and Microsoft’s function, with the floating button and turning off the show, was clearly impressed by the Mac Digital Show function of visionOS. And now, the businesses appear to be taking inspiration from Apple but once more.

The core distinction between the 2 platforms was that Quest 3 supplied you digital aspect displays, whereas Apple Imaginative and prescient Professional allows you to flip your display right into a digital vast or ultrawide monitor.

Now, Meta and Microsoft are providing you the selection, and have added a brand new portrait side ratio selection too.

By default, your digital displays are common 16:9 widescreen, which Meta labels “Compact”. However, as delivered to our consideration by Luna, now you can set any display to “Portrait” (3:4) or “Large” (21:9).

You possibly can organize your as much as three digital displays with any configuration of those three side ratio decisions. So you’ll be able to, for instance, have a 16:9 primary display and a 3:4 aspect display, as you’ll be able to see within the picture on the prime of the article.

Along with these decisions, there’s additionally an Ultrawide Mode. Like on the identically labeled possibility in Mac Digital Show, Ultrawide Mode turns your single display into a very large curved digital show that engulfs your horizontal subject of view. Just one digital monitor is supported on this mode, and the window prompts the Horizon OS Focus Mode, previously often known as Theater Mode, which helps you to regulate the dimming of your background.

Compact, Portrait, Large, and Ultrawide.

What Meta and Microsoft’s system nonetheless lacks, although, is arguably crucial side of Mac Digital Show: its computerized ad-hoc connection. Apple’s function immediately and routinely creates a direct wi-fi connection between the Imaginative and prescient headset and the Mac. That signifies that whereas you should utilize Apple Imaginative and prescient Professional to immediately create a large non-public wi-fi show to your MacBook on a airplane or prepare you’d want to make use of a show cable to do the identical with a Quest 3.
